Job Title: Vice Principal

Location: Atosin Idanre, Ondo
Employment Type: Full-time

Job Description

  • The Vice Principal plays a pivotal role in leading and managing a prestigious international and British school in Nigeria.
  • This is a senior leadership position that demands a passionate and experienced educator to oversee various aspects of the school's operations.

Responsibilities
Academic Leadership & Standards:

  • Oversee the implementation of the British curriculum, ensuring it aligns with Nigerian regulations.
  • Lead and support teachers in delivering high-quality instruction.
  • Monitor academic progress and identify areas for improvement.
  • Conduct regular classroom observations and provide feedback to teachers.
  • Manage curriculum development and ensure it meets international standards.

Student Wellbeing & Pastoral Care:

  • Work closely with the Principal to create a safe and inclusive learning environment.
  • Address student concerns and implement disciplinary measures when necessary.
  • Foster a positive school culture that celebrates diversity.
  • Collaborate with counselors and other staff to support student well-being.

Staff Leadership & Development:

  • Supervise and mentor teachers, providing professional development opportunities.
  • Conduct performance evaluations and offer constructive feedback.
  • Build a strong team spirit among faculty and staff.
  • Oversee the recruitment and onboarding of new staff.

Operational Management:

  • Assist the Principal in managing the day-to-day operations of the school.
  • Ensure compliance with all relevant regulations and policies.
  • Develop and manage the school budget (depending on the specific structure).
  • Oversee communication with parents and the wider school community.

Qualifications

  • Degree in Education or a relevant field (preferred)
  • Extensive experience in a senior leadership role within an international or British school setting
  • Proven track record of improving academic achievement
  • Excellent le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ills
  • Strong understanding of the British curriculum and its adaptation to the Nigerian context
  • Fluency in English and a commitment to fostering a multicultural learning environment.
